Output 3cb61fe682ecac4e5bd8c8b3a4e5714a9ad99962f20b93b972644a5356011a4e:1

value
9095437
script pubkey
OP_0 OP_PUSHBYTES_20 c0049924d386c21071a07da3d022e9ea843b4f5b
address
bc1qcqzfjfxnsmppqudq0k3aqghfa2zrkn6m0vg3m9
transaction
3cb61fe682ecac4e5bd8c8b3a4e5714a9ad99962f20b93b972644a5356011a4e
confirmations
22261
spent
true